Stock Photo - Half-timbered houses on the river Ill, La Petite France, Strasbourg, Alsace, France

Stock Photo: Half-timbered houses on the river Ill, La Petite France, Strasbourg, Alsace, France.

Searchable keywords

Choose multiple keywords